What is Global Military Night Vision Goggles Market?

The Global Military Night Vision Goggles Market refers to the worldwide industry focused on the production, distribution, and utilization of night vision goggles specifically designed for military applications. These devices enable military personnel to see in low-light or completely dark environments by amplifying available light or using infrared technology. The market encompasses a variety of products, including monocular and binocular night vision goggles, each with unique features and capabilities tailored to different military needs. The demand for these advanced optical devices is driven by the need for enhanced situational awareness, improved operational effectiveness, and increased safety during nighttime missions. As military operations often occur in challenging and unpredictable environments, night vision goggles play a crucial role in ensuring that soldiers can navigate, identify targets, and execute missions effectively, regardless of lighting conditions. The market is characterized by continuous technological advancements, with manufacturers striving to develop more efficient, durable, and user-friendly devices to meet the evolving demands of modern warfare.

Monocular Military Night Vision Goggles, Binocular Military Night Vision Goggles in the Global Military Night Vision Goggles Market:

Monocular Military Night Vision Goggles and Binocular Military Night Vision Goggles are two primary types of night vision devices used in the Global Military Night Vision Goggles Market. Monocular night vision goggles consist of a single eyepiece and are typically lighter and more compact than their binocular counterparts. They are favored for their portability and ease of use, making them ideal for situations where quick deployment and mobility are essential. Monocular goggles are often used by soldiers for navigation, surveillance, and target acquisition, providing a significant advantage in low-light conditions. On the other hand, Binocular Military Night Vision Goggles feature two eyepieces, offering a more immersive and natural viewing experience. These goggles provide better depth perception and a wider field of view, which can be crucial in complex and dynamic combat scenarios. Binocular goggles are commonly used in reconnaissance missions, search and rescue operations, and other tasks that require detailed observation and situational awareness. Both types of goggles utilize advanced image intensification technology to amplify available light, allowing users to see clearly in the dark. Some models also incorporate thermal imaging capabilities, which detect heat signatures and can be particularly useful in identifying hidden or camouflaged targets. The choice between monocular and binocular night vision goggles often depends on the specific requirements of the mission and the preferences of the user. While monocular goggles offer greater flexibility and ease of movement, binocular goggles provide enhanced visual clarity and depth perception. National Defense, Military in the Global Military Night Vision Goggles Market:

The usage of Global Military Night Vision Goggles Market in areas such as National Defense and Military is extensive and multifaceted. In National Defense, night vision goggles are indispensable tools for border security, surveillance, and reconnaissance missions. They enable defense personnel to monitor and secure national borders effectively, even in complete darkness. This capability is crucial for detecting and intercepting illegal activities such as smuggling, human trafficking, and unauthorized border crossings. Night vision goggles also play a vital role in coastal and maritime security, allowing naval forces to conduct patrols, identify potential threats, and ensure the safety of national waters. In the broader context of Military operations, night vision goggles are essential for enhancing the effectiveness and safety of soldiers during nighttime missions. They provide a significant tactical advantage by allowing troops to navigate, communicate, and engage targets in low-light conditions. This is particularly important in modern warfare, where operations often take place in urban environments, dense forests, or other challenging terrains. Night vision goggles enable soldiers to move stealthily, avoid detection, and maintain situational awareness, thereby increasing the likelihood of mission success. Additionally, these devices are used in various specialized military applications, such as special forces operations, search and rescue missions, and counter-terrorism efforts. Special forces units rely on night vision goggles for covert operations, where the ability to see in the dark can mean the difference between success and failure. In search and rescue missions, night vision goggles help locate and assist individuals in distress, even in the most challenging conditions. Counter-terrorism units use these devices to conduct surveillance, gather intelligence, and execute precise operations against terrorist threats. The versatility and reliability of night vision goggles make them indispensable assets for military forces worldwide. Global Military Night Vision Goggles Market Outlook:

The global Military Night Vision Goggles market was valued at US$ 824 million in 2023 and is anticipated to reach US$ 1262.2 million by 2030, witnessing a CAGR of 6.5% during the forecast period 2024-2030. This growth trajectory highlights the increasing demand for advanced night vision technology in military applications worldwide.
